Senior Tax Associate, National Tax Office – Compensation and Benefits

Armanino

Tax Senior Associate role at Armanino supporting executive compensation and benefits tax matters. Involves technical tax research, reporting considerations, and client communication.

Posted 6/19/2026full-timeSan Ramon • California, Utah, Washington • 🇺🇸 United StatesSenior💰 $83,200 - $113,300 per yearW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Support executive compensation and benefits tax matters, including equity compensation, deferred compensation and 409A, Sections 162(m) and 280G, payroll taxes, and related reporting considerations under ASC 718 and ASC 740
  • Research and prepare compensation planning and benchmarking analyses for executive compensation models
  • Perform technical tax research, identify when additional analysis is needed, and apply appropriate guidance
  • Support the partner team with practice strategy, planning, budgeting, and the development of new delivery capabilities to meet evolving market needs
  • Communicate with clients through clear verbal communication and professional written deliverables, including technical memoranda and tax opinions

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ting or related field
  • Minimum of 2 years’ experience in corporate tax, accounting, or legal
  • CPA, Juris Doctor or equivalent credential preferred
  • Experience with compensation & benefits
